摘要:随着Kotlin语言的兴起,其简洁、安全的特点受到了越来越多开发者的青睐。其中,Kotlin的空安全特性是区别于Java的一个重要特点。本文将深入探讨Kotlin与Java在空安全方面的差异,并介绍如何在Ko
非空断言操作符
摘要:在Kotlin编程语言中,空指针异常是常见的运行时错误之一。本文将深入探讨Kotlin中避免空指针异常的策略,并通过实际代码示例展示如何在Kotlin项目中有效预防此类异常的发生。 一、 Kotlin作为An
摘要:随着Kotlin语言的普及,其空安全(Null Safety)特性成为开发者关注的焦点。空安全是Kotlin语言的核心特性之一,旨在减少因空指针异常导致的程序崩溃。本文将围绕Kotlin语言的空安全代码审查展
Kotlin 语言中的非空断言操作符应用场景 在Kotlin编程语言中,非空断言操作符(!!)是一种强大的工具,它允许开发者对变量进行非空检查,并在变量为空时抛出异常。这种操作符在处理可能为null的变量时特别有
摘要:星投影(Star Projection)是Kotlin语言中一种强大的特性,它允许开发者以简洁的方式处理可空类型。本文将围绕Kotlin语言中的星投影,探讨其使用场景、方法以及在实际开发中的应用。 一、 在K
摘要:在Java中,多线程并行流提供了高效的并发处理能力,但在使用过程中,如果不注意空安全,很容易出现NullPointerException。本文将围绕Java多线程并行流,探讨三个避免NullPointerEx
摘要:Dart语言作为一种现代化的编程语言,以其简洁、高效的特点受到了广泛欢迎。在Dart中,非空断言操作符(!)是一个非常有用的特性,它可以帮助开发者避免在运行时因空值导致的错误。本文将深入探讨Dart中的非空断